This wedding was held during the daytime because you can clearly see the light through the window in the painting. The single burning candle in the chandelier was not needed to light up the room. This candle symbolizes the union candle or could even symbolize the presence of God. In the Renaissance culture, a devotional candle signified God’s all-seeing knowledge (Pioch)...
